Our long flared Redingote coats are some of our most popular items and the pics show a few custom versions.

One in navy blue wool melton (a heavy felted wool), one in pale green embroidered linen, and one, with a hood, that is cut from a deep olive green worsted flannel and lined in scarlet paisley.

The steampunk map coat that is shown is made from a heavy tapestry brocade that has great body, and has gear buttons.

This coat is shown in a plus size, but every coat that we make can be cut in larger (and smaller) sizes as well.

The ivory coat is a 3/4 sleeve cotton trench coat in spring weight cotton twill.

The remainder of the coats are some of our awesome leather jackets. The black coat is a motorcycle jacket that is cut from genuine shearling lambskin with a sueded exterior and classic salt and pepper fur inside.

The collar is cut from longhair toscana sheepskin.  It is shown with a braided leather belt that we cut to go with the coat and decorated with metal studs. The coat is unique and shaped to match the raw edges of the hides.

The deep rust color leather jacket is a custom safari jacket cut from beautiful suede with a leather belt.  We can make safari jackets in wools and leathers in a multitude of colors and styles.

The reddish brown jacket is a bull hide motorcycle jacket with a shearling collar and trim. Shearing is wonderful as a collar, and the short navy zip up coat with a shearling collar was another of our favorite projects.

 

Finally the brown coat with a fur collar is one of our custom deerskin dusters.

This one with a collar made from sheared beaver, rust stitching, and embossed Victorian-era copper buttons.
